      What to Expect (Job Responsibilities):
      - Produce accurate geospatial data and mapping products for documenting trust lands and encumbrances
      - Support migration of Land Area Code (LAC) data into the ESRI Enterprise Parcel Fabric
      - Create dashboards and dynamic views for project tracking and geospatial decision-making
      - Administer geospatial databases and conduct quality control processes within the ESRI parcel fabric environment
      - Collaborate with various teams to assist in the Fee-to-Trust process and develop metadata for new digital spatial datasets

      What is Required (Qualifications):
      - Bachelor's degree in Geography, GIS, Environmental Science, Natural Resources, or a related field; equivalent experience considered
      - Experience interpreting legal land descriptions, rights-of-way, and lease information
      - Proficiency with the ESRI suite (ArcGIS Pro, Enterprise, Parcel Fabric) and similar platforms
      - Strong analytical, problem-solving, and documentation skills
      - Ability to collaborate effectively with a variety of technical and program stakeholders

      How to Stand Out (Preferred Qualifications):
      - Prior experience with parcel mapping, land records, ESRI Parcel Fabric, or trust land datasets
